Suntory Kin-Mugi

Official Link, complete with hyperbolic hype, and some sort of Asian-Spanish fusion music. Oh joy!

Suntory, the youngest of the SAKS¹ Bunch, has in the past always tried to step outside of the norms that it's competitors have set. For example, I still remember with a fair amount of whimsy their Table [Red] Beer, complete with mini-booklet hanging by a string from the bottle's neck, that explained that a "fine" beer should be poured into a wine glass. Points for shooting for the high-end of the beer market, I say.

But as time has gone by, I see more and more offerings from Suntory that dumb-down their message, as they seemingly fall in lock-step with the rest of the Japanese Big Three.

This beer, for example? Might as as well be a rebranding of a dozen other Happoshu offerings from any of the SAKS'ers. Not necessarily the very worst of the bunch -- many other Happoshus out there worse than this, that I have unceremoniously dumped down the drain -- but hardly worth much mention or attention.

As much as I have quietly rooted for Suntory to kick ass and force the other Japanese brewers to raise the bar, it just looks to me that Suntory is simply pumping out shite to compete for the bottom end of the marketplace instead. With snoozers such as this leading the charge.
//TB

 


¹ Sapporo-Asahi-Kirin-Suntory, in approx. order of quality....
